CPR masks and shields are essential life-saving tools that provide a barrier between the rescuer and the patient during cardiopulmonary resuscitation. These devices are designed to prevent the transmission of infectious diseases and to ensure that the rescuer can perform CPR safely and effectively. CPR masks and shields come in a variety of shapes and sizes, and they are typically made of high-quality materials that are easy to clean and disinfect. They are an essential addition to any first aid kit or emergency response kit, and they are highly recommended for anyone who wishes to provide basic life support to a person in need.

3. Do CPR face shields work?
First, it's important to realize that a CPR mask, officially known as a barrier device, is for keeping you—the rescuer—safe. It doesn't make rescue breaths more effective than straight mouth-to-mouth. Also, most rescuers aren't going to give rescue breaths anyway.
